
Tottenham fans have taken to Twitter to react after they spotted Pierre-Emile Højbjerg fiddling with Martin Atkinson’s vanishing spray against Arsenal.
After Harry Kane and Gabriel Magalhães clashed heads in the 92nd minute, the Denmark international was spotted pressing the spray while it was still in Atkinson’s belt.
After the referee then readjusts his belt, Højbjerg does it again!
As some fans have asked below, what is he doing?
It looks as if the former Bayern Munich man is trying to spray Atkinson’s back, or he could simply be intrigued by the tool and wants to get a closer look.

Whatever the reason, it clearly piqued the Tottenham fans’ interest enough to be discussing it long after full-time.
In terms of Højbjerg’s performance, the Dane was out of this world.
As WhoScored shows, Tottenham’s No.5 completed eight clearances, two interceptions and one tackle.

Højbjerg also recorded two dribbles and won three fouls from Arsenal in the solid 2-0 win over Mikel Arteta’s Gunners.
Jose Mourinho’s men now sit top of the Premier League on goal difference ahead of Liverpool, having won seven of their 11 games this season.
